The Boston Tea Party chest holds historical significance in American history as it symbolizes the act of protest against British taxation without representation. This event, where colonists dumped tea into Boston Harbor in 1773, was a key moment leading to the American Revolution and the fight for independence from British rule.
The Robinson Tea Chest was one of the tea chests thrown into the Boston Harbor during the Boston Tea Party in 1773. Its significance lies in symbolizing the colonists' protest against British taxation without representation, leading to the American Revolution.
A group of 30 to 130 men some of them thinly disguised as Mohawk indians that boarded the three vessel and over the course of three hours dumped all chest of tea into the water.
